Wiegmann WAXM-U SERIES ENCLOSURES Catalog Page

Page 1
FEATURES-SPECIFICATIONS
Industry Standards
UL 508, Type 12 CSA Certified, Type 12 NEMA/EEMAC Type 12 JIC EL-1-71
UL File E64791
CSA File LL66078
WAXM-U SERIES ENCLOSURES NEMA 12 HEAVY DUTY FREESTANDING DISCONNECT
Applications
Designed to house the following:
Allen-Bradley Bulletin 1494F flange-
mounted disconnect switches and Bulletin 1494D flange-mounted operators for circuit breaker. Allen­Bradley Bulletin 1494V variable depth flange-operated disconnect switches and circuit breakers mechanisms
ABB Controls flange-mounted
variable depth operating mechanisms for disconnect switches and circuit breakers
Cutler-Hammer/Westinghouse
Type C361 disconnect switches and operator mechanisms. Cutler-Hammer Type C371 circuit breaker operating mechanisms. Also Type SM safety handle mechanisms and Flex Shaft™ handle operators for circuit breakers
General Electric Type STDA flange
handles and variable depth operating mechanisms for disconnect switches and circuit breakers. Also Spectra Flex™ cable operators for circuit breakers
I-T-E Max-Flex™ flange-mounted
variable depth operating handles for disconnect switches and circuit breakers
Square D disconnect switches
and circuit breakers used with Class 9422 flange-mounted variable depth operating mechanisms or cable mechanism
These enclosures will not receive Class 9422 bracket-mounted discon­nect devices or Class 9422TG1 or TG2 devices
Construction
• Bodies and doors fabricated from 10 gauge steel.
• Removable 10 gauge steel back panels are included and mounted on collar studs
• Continuously welded seams ground smooth
• Body stiffeners provided for extra rigidity
• Heavy duty lifting eyes and provisions for fluorescent lighting are provided
• Heavy gauge lift off hinges
• 3-point padlocking handles on all doors
• Panel supports
• Center posts are removable to permit easy panel installation.
• Print pocket is provided
• Grounding provisions provided
• Doors are supplied with closed cell neoprene gasket
• Unless specified, the far right door is considered to be the "Master" door. All other doors are considered slave doors
• The mechanical interlock is activated by the master door which prevents the slave doors from being opened first. Doors can be closed in any order
• Disconnects come with a universal cutout which provides mounting for most disconnect operators by using operator adapters
• FTC rolled lip around all sides of enclosure opening excludes liquids and contaminants
Finish
• ANSI 61 gray polyester powder inside and out over phosphatized surfaces
• Included back panels are white polyester powder over phosphatized surfaces
Accessories
• See pages J1-J20
• Blank adapter plates on pages F57 and J12
IMPORTANT
• Disconnect switch or circuit breakers, operating handle and operating mechanism are not furnished with enclosure and must be ordered separately from the disconnect manufacturer
Operator adapter plates are required with this enclosure and must be purchased separately. See pages F57 and K12 to select the proper operator adapter for the brand and type of disconnect being used
• Disconnect ordering information is located on page F41
• Review space occupied by discon­nect drawings on page F40 and disconnect tables on pages F47-F56 to determine if the disconnect device you are using will fit the enclosure size you have selected

Space Occupied by Disconnect
Note:
1. See pages F47-F56 for various brands of disconnects for “E”, “F”, “G” and WB dimensions.
2. Disconnects will occupy space on panel shown by dimensions “E”, “F” and “G”. Wiring space WB is available when disconnect is installed in the enclosure.
3. When ordering 24.13 (613mm) deep enclosures, long connecting rods must be ordered. Long connecting rods are available from disconnect manufacturers.
ABB Controls flange-operated devices
Cutter-Hammer C361 devices
Cutler-Hammer C371 operating mechanisms C371E and C371F, order catalog number
C371CS1 connecting rod. For C371G and C371K, order catalog number C371CS2 con­necting rod.
General Electric TDA devices, order catalog number TDSR extended length drive rod
For Square D 9422 devices, order catalog number 9422-R2 extra long operating rod(s).
Some devices require two rods.
Refer to National Electrical Code
®
1996 article 430-10(b) for wiring space required for line side
conductors to be connected to disconnect. Verify your application to determine if wiring space is adequate.
